I have a 2004 Honda Civic EX (coupe). I was struggling with a steering wheel cover when my steering wheel locked up. I then attempted to start my car to unlock it, but it won't allow me to turn the key. It isn't stuck and the key was all the way in; I tried pushing in, pulling it out a little, but it's like the key doesn't even belong to the car.
I got my spare key, but it also will not work. I am currently giving it time to see if it will unlock after a specific amount of time. My Honda Dealer is closed, as is the Honda help line. My car's manual gives me no information on a situation like this. Other than waiting to see if it'll allow me to use my key later, what do you suggest? -Ashaera ![]() |
|
|||
|
Ashaera,
To fix your problem, you have to turn the steering wheel either to the left or right as much as you can, then try to turn the key in the ignition. When the steering wheel locks, the key won't turn. By manually holding the steering wheel out of the lock position, the key will turn again and you're steering column will be back to normal.
